    Lawrence would be top 10, if not top 5 pick if it weren't for his off the field issues. He tested positive for PEDs and got suspended for the last few games including the playoffs.

    However, if you watch his tape his is a monster. He consistently moves offensive linemen backwards and collapses the pocket - something we need very much, especially if we hope to ever beat the Colts. If you ask me, he's worth the risk at #19.
